2. Parenting How much does it cost and what materials should be prepared?

A paternity test generally costs 2,000-3,000 yuan, and the results will be available in 3-7 days. The personal appraisal fee is about 1,000 yuan per person. If it is just a personal entrustment of appraisal, it will not be used for judicial purposes.way. Only identification samples are required. You can make parent-child relationships for samples. The approximate cost of identification is: 1,000 yuan per person for blood stains, and a total of about 2,000 yuan for father and son identification. If you want to do a forensic appraisal with judicial effect, you need to provide: the identity document of the person being appraised (if the child does not have an ID card, the household registration book or birth medical certificate will be provided), a copy, and 2 one-inch or two-inch photos for each person. All persons being appraised will be present in person, their documents will be checked, their fingerprints will be collected, and samples will be taken. The appraisal report has judicial effect nationwide. The approximate cost of identification is: 1,200-1,500 yuan per person for blood stains, and a total of about 3,000 yuan for father and son identification.

4. What does a paternity test report generally include

Paternity test The report is divided into a name, introduction, main text, attachments, signature of the appraiser, and statement. The client should mainly focus on the main text of the appraisal report, which includes the following five points.

1. The person being appraised or the materials being inspected: Depending on the nature of the report, the formal appraisal report provides the information of the person being appraised, such as name, ID card, and birth certificate. Number, etc.;

2. Inspection material processing and inspection methods: This part mainly introduces the inspection methods, kits and main inspection instruments used.

3. Test results: The test results are the reflection of the original results;

4. Analysis Note: This is the part that analyzes and discusses the test principles and test results. For the appraisal report to determine the paternity relationship, it must include some necessary calculation data such as the paternity index and the relative chance of paternity;

5. Inspection conclusion: Give the final conclusion on the entrusted matter according to the request of the entrusting party.

5. What samples are needed for paternity testing without children

Forensic Testing of Southwest University of Political Science and Law The center tells you
The samples for paternity testing include: 15-20 hairs with hair follicles; blood stains; oral test strips
●Hair collection
Have a blank piece of paper ready.
Pull out the hair from the head (move quickly, it is best to pull out both hairs at the same time), and observe with the naked eye whether there is a translucent capsule-like object at the root of the hair. The removed hair cannot touch the hair follicles with your hands. Wrap it in A4 paper and put it in an envelope. Mark the identity and name of the person to whom the sample belongs on the surface of the envelope. Each person needs 15-20 sticks.
●Bloodstain collection
Use a needle to lightly prick the skin surface (fingertips, earlobes, heels and any part of the body surface). When the blood flows out, wipe it gently with the prepared gauze (available in large and small pharmacies), leaving 5-6 on the surface. A blood mark as big as a soybean is sufficient.
Wrap it in white paper or an envelope, not in a plastic bag. Mark the envelope with the identity and name of the person to whom the sample belongs. Note: The person who collects blood has not transfused blood from others within half a year and has not had a bone marrow transplant within two years.
●Oral mucosa collection
Purchase single-head disinfectant cotton swabs from the drug store, three per person. Pick up a cotton swab and put it into your mouth and scrape back and forth on the muscle wall on the inside of your cheek to make the cotton head fully moist, and scrape it 20 times. The second one is scraped 20 times on the other side. Scrape the third one 10 times on each side and take it out.
Wrap it in white paper or an envelope, and mark the identity and name of the person to whom the sample belongs on the surface of the envelope. Note: Do not use plastic bags.
